This is a good quality and triple panel Charles II English antique oak coffer, attributable to the West Country, England, circa 1650 - 1700. The coffer features a triple panel design with three panels to the lid and front of the coffer. Constructed in the traditional peg construction method, the coffer features a channel-moulded frame. The upper section of the coffer boasts a row of lunette carvings and below, there are three diamond shaped lozenges with floral centres. The lid is connected to the base with the original hand beaten iron loop hinges. Inside, there is the original candle box to the right hand side. There is also a working lock and key with this coffer which locks the top lid onto the base. The coffer sits on its original style feet, which is rare to see. The back of the coffer features the original rough-hewn back and original floor. This coffer has sought after proportions not being too tall. This coffer would have been commissioned for a wealthy country homeowner.

The interior is clean, dry and the coffer is practical and useable. The exterior of the coffer boasts a stunning rich oak colour patination. This is an important oak coffer having been around in the days of Charles II, Cromwell’s conquest of Ireland & Scotland and the Great Fire of London. Condition Report:

The frame of the coffer is original featuring the original floor, top, sides and back. The coffer stands on its original styles. The working lock and key are very old replacements. The iron hand beaten loop hinges are original. The interior is clean, dry and the coffer is practical and useable. Free of active woodworm. The coffer is solid in joint and ready to use. Considering the age of this early coffer, it is in very good condition and does not detract from its attractive appeal.
